Summary:
The 48229 zip code area in Michigan is home to 6 schools, including 2 elementary schools, 1 middle school, 2 high schools, and 1 alternative school. Overall, the schools in this area are consistently underperforming, with very low proficiency rates on state assessments across all grade levels and subject areas.
The standout schools in this area are not performing well. GrandPort Elementary Academy, a middle school, has consistently low performance, ranking in the bottom 10-15% of Michigan middle schools over the past 3 years. Its proficiency rates on state assessments are well below the state averages, with only 15-21% of students proficient in ELA and 4-5% proficient in math. Ecorse Community High School also performs poorly, ranking in the bottom 5-10% of Michigan high schools, with only 7-14% of students proficient in science, social studies, and SAT reading/writing.
The alternative and virtual schools in the area, Hope Academic Academy and Downriver Digital Academy, serve a highly disadvantaged population, with very high free/reduced lunch rates of over 90%. However, these schools also have very high student-teacher ratios, which may limit the level of individualized support available to students. Overall, the data points to the need for significant interventions and support to improve educational outcomes for students in this Ecorse Public Schools district.
